There are many from the “Kleberfamilie” of Patex, UHU, etc. it must be suitable for the materials, it is important in all cases to observe the instructions, because some have to be brushed on both sides, “ventilated” and then combined with solid pressure, others are simply coated, joined together and dried. Make it fat free before!

The attaching of the magnets is probably the simple, problems could arise when removing the foil attached thereto, which could tear depending on how strong the magnets are!
